The important issue from this AV report:
According to information The Aviation Herald received on March 4th 2017 the CL-604 passed 1000 feet below an Airbus A380-800 while enroute over the Arabic Sea, when a short time later (1-2 minutes) the aircraft encountered wake turbulence sending the aircraft in uncontrolled roll turning the aircraft around at least 3 times (possibly even 5 times)
So the aircraft were flying apart and 1 - 2 minutes later the Challenger was rolled by the wake. That must be 20 - 30 miles behind the 380 and a thousand feet below it the wake was strong enough to roll a bizjet. For those offsetting a couple of miles to avoid wake that may well not be enough with these kinds of figures.

It may also explain the occasional CAT with pax and flight attendants hurt when the flight was otherwise smooth who would suspect an aircraft 30+ miles away?
